然而,随着虚拟化环境的复杂化,数据安全和文件完整性验证成为了不可忽视的重要环节
本文将深入探讨VMware中如何高效验证文件的完整性与安全性,确保虚拟化环境的稳健运行
一、文件验证的重要性 在虚拟化环境中,文件是承载业务数据和应用程序的基础
文件的完整性直接关系到系统的稳定性和数据的安全性
一旦文件被篡改或损坏,可能会导致虚拟机无法启动、应用程序崩溃、数据丢失等严重后果
因此,验证文件的完整性是保障虚拟化环境安全的第一步
二、VMware中的文件验证机制 VMware提供了一系列工具和方法来验证文件的完整性,主要包括散列校验、数字签名、配置文件检查等
这些机制共同构成了VMware虚拟化环境中的文件验证体系
1. 散列校验 散列校验是验证文件完整性的常用方法
VMware通过计算文件的散列值(如MD5、SHA-1、SHA-256等),并与已知的正确散列值进行比较,来判断文件是否被篡改
散列值具有唯一性和不可逆性,即使文件内容发生微小变化,其散列值也会发生显著变化
因此,散列校验能够准确检测文件的完整性
在VMware环境中,管理员可以使用命令行工具或第三方软件来计算和比较文件的散列值
例如,使用`md5sum`或`sha256sum`命令来计算文件的MD5或SHA-256散列值,并与官方提供的散列值进行比对
2. 数字签名 数字签名是另一种验证文件完整性和真实性的有效手段
VMware为其软件产品提供了数字签名,以确保用户下载和安装的是官方发布的正版软件
数字签名通过加密技术将文件与发布者的身份绑定在一起,任何对文件的篡改都会导致数字签名验证失败
在Windows操作系统中,当用户下载并安装VMware软件时,系统会自动验证软件的数字签名
如果签名验证失败,系统会发出警告,提示用户该软件可能已被篡改或损坏
3. 配置文件检查 VMware虚拟化环境中的配置文件(如VMX文件)包含了虚拟机的配置信息
这些配置文件的完整性对于虚拟机的正常运行至关重要
VMware提供了配置文件检查工具,用于验证配置文件的语法和内容的正确性
管理员可以使用VMware提供的命令行工具(如`vmkfstools`)或图形化管理界面(如vSphere Client)来检查虚拟机的配置文件
这些工具能够自动检测配置文件中的错误和不一致之处,并提供修复建议
三、实践中的文件验证策略 为了确保虚拟化环境中文件的完整性和安全性,管理员需要制定并执行一套有效的文件验证策略
以下是一些实践中的建议: 1. 定期验证文件完整性 管理员应定期使用散列校验和数字签名验证工具来检查关键文件的完整性
这包括操作系统文件、应用程序文件、VMware软件安装包等
通过定期验证,可以及时发现并修复被篡改或损坏的文件
2. 使用官方渠道下载和更新软件 为了避免下载到恶意软件或篡改过的软件,管理员应始终使用VMware官方渠道下载和更新软件
官方渠道提供的软件经过严格的测试和验证,具有更高的安全性和可靠性
3. 配置自动化监控和报警系统 管理员可以配置自动化监控和报警系统来实时监控虚拟化环境中的文件变化
当检测到文件被篡改或损坏时,系统会自动发出报警并通知管理员
这有助于管理员及时发现并处理问题,防止事态扩大
4. 定期备份重要文件 定期备份重要文件是防止数据丢失的有效手段
管理员应制定备份计划,并定期将关键文件备份到安全的存储介质中
在文件被篡改或损坏时,可以从备份中恢复原始文件,确保业务的连续性
5. 加强访问控制和权限管理 加强访问控制和权限管理是防止文件被恶意篡改的重要措施
管理员应为不同用户分配适当的权限,确保只有授权用户才能访问和修改关键文件
同时,还应定期审查和调整权限设置,以适应业务发展和安全需求的变化
四、案例分析:VMware文件验证的实践应用 以下是一个关于VMware文件验证的实践案例,展示了如何在虚拟化环境中高效验证文件的完整性和安全性
某企业采用VMware虚拟化技术部署了多个虚拟机来承载其核心业务
为了确保虚拟机的稳定运行和数据的安全性,管理员制定了严格的文件验证策略
他们定期使用散列校验工具来检查虚拟机的操作系统文件、应用程序文件和配置文件
同时,他们还配置了自动化监控和报警系统来实时监控文件的变化
在某次定期验证过程中,管理员发现一台虚拟机的操作系统文件被篡改
通过查看监控日志和报警信息,管理员迅速定位了篡改行为的来源,并采取了相应的安全措施来消除威胁
由于及时发现了问题并采取了有效的应对措施,该企业的业务没有受到任何影响
五、结论 VMware作为虚拟化技术的领导者,提供了丰富的工具和方法来验证文件的完整性和安全性
通过定期验证文件完整性、使用官方渠道下载和更新软件、配置自动化监控和报警系统、定期备份重要文件以及加强访问控制和权限管理等措施,管理员可以确保虚拟化环境中文件的完整性和安全性
这些实践策略不仅有助于防止数据丢失和恶意攻击,还能提高虚拟化环境的稳定性和可靠性
在未来的虚拟化技术发展中,文件验证将继续发挥重要作用,为企业的数字化转型提供有力保障